This Sunday I will be at the
Greater Worcester Coin Show, better known as the "Auburn show", since it is held at the Elks Lodge in Auburn Massachusetts, located just south of Worcester. It is a fairly large show which features dealers from CT and Mass, with some from NY. Not uppity - blue jeans. Lots of
US coins, from inexpensive ones in the binders to several hundred dollar slabs. A few dealers have medals and tokens, some notes, some world coins and some ancients. No stamps. Lately they have not been charging admission. Parking is free and usually there is no problem finding a parking spot. Before noon is best; 2pm is when many of the dealers pack up.
